MySQL是一種常用的關系型數據庫管理系統(RDBMS),具有高度的可定制性和可擴展性。在使用MySQL時,通過遍歷可以方便地查找數據并進行相關操作。
/* 遍歷表中所有數據 */ SELECT * FROM table_name; /* 遍歷表中指定的數據 */ SELECT column_name1, column_name2 FROM table_name; /* 按條件遍歷數據 */ SELECT * FROM table_name WHERE column_name = 'condition'; /* 遍歷部分數據 */ SELECT * FROM table_name LIMIT start_num, count; /* 倒序遍歷數據 */ SELECT * FROM table_name ORDER BY column_name DESC; /* 限制遍歷返回數據的數量 */ SELECT * FROM table_name LIMIT count; /* 遍歷唯一的數據 */ SELECT DISTINCT column_name FROM table_name; /* 遍歷數據并進行計算 */ SELECT column_name1, column_name2, SUM(column_name3) AS column_name4 FROM table_name WHERE column_name = 'condition' GROUP BY column_name1; /* 多表遍歷 */ SELECT table_name1.column_name1, table_name2.column_name2 FROM table_name1, table_name2 WHERE table_name1.column_name = table_name2.column_name; /* 遍歷數據并進行連接 */ SELECT table_name1.*, table_name2.column_name2 FROM table_name1 LEFT JOIN table_name2 ON table_name1.column_name = table_name2.column_name;
通過以上示例,可以看出MySQL遍歷的多種方式和使用場景。合理使用遍歷可以提高數據搜索和操作的效率,進而優化整個系統的性能和穩定性。